50,000 kids explore the outdoors
Nature Canada and Parks Canada have helped almost 50,000 children to experience nature firsthand through the Parks and People program. The goal is to involve youth in conservation through education about the environment. Read some recent program highlights from across the country.

Water: Conflicting Attitudes, Actions
The latest Canadian Water Attitudes Study shows our perceptions don’t match our habits when it comes to freshwater resources. Most Canadians believe conserving water is important, yet continue to use it at an alarming rate.
